Zanzibar is the most complete island in Africa à a place where every element of a great travel experience converges: extraordinary history, warm culture, world-class beaches, coral reefs, and a cuisine that still carries the flavour of centuries of Indian Ocean trade.

The island known internationally as Zanzibar à officially called Unguja à sits in the warm Indian Ocean 36 km off the Tanzanian coast, at the same latitude as Mozambique and just south of the equator. It is 85 km long and 39 km wide, with an area of 1,464 kmà and a coastline that stretches over 100 km di sabbia bianca che orla barriere coralline e altro ancora luminous turquoise water in Africa orientale.

Zanzibar's history is written in its streets, its architecture, its food, and its people. For centuries, the island was the fulcrum of Indian Ocean trade à cloves, ivory, and enslaved people passed through its harbour, and the great powers of the world competed for control of its commerce. Portuguese (1503à1698), Omani Arabs (1698à1890), and British (1890à1963) each left architectural and cultural traces that today make Stone Town one of the world's most layered and richly textured historic cities. In 2000, UNESCO inscribed Stone Town as a World Heritage Site, recognising its unique blend of Arab, Persian, Indian, and European influences in a single compact urban environment.

Today Zanzibar attracts over 900,000 visitors annually à drawn by the beaches, the diving, the Stone Town experience, and the island's identity as the perfect end to a Tanzania safari. A 45-minute flight from Arusha or Kilimanjaro airport places you from the open savanna of the Serengeti directly onto the white sand of Nungwi or Kendwa à one of travel's most satisfying transitions. Stone Town
UNESCO World Heritage à Since 2000

The former capital of the Zanzibar Sultanate is one of the world's most intact historic trading cities à a labyrinth of coral stone alleyways, elaborately carved wooden doors, Arabic balconies, Indian verandas, and European colonial facades all compressed into a few walkable square kilometres. The Old Fort (17th century, Omani), the House of Wonders (1883, first building in Africa orientale with electricity), Freddie Mercury's birthplace, the former Slave Market site, and the nightly Forodhani food market make Stone Town an essential 2-night cultural immersion before any Spiaggia stay.

Il giro delle spezie
Cloves à Vanilla à Cinnamon à Nutmeg

Zanzibar earned the name "Spice Island" through its clove industry à which at its peak in the 19th century made it the world's largest clove producer. Oggi le piantagioni di spezie nell'entroterra dell'isola coltivano oltre 50 varietà di spezie e frutti tropicali in una fitta foresta aromatica: cloves, vanilla, cinnamon, turmeric, cardamom, lemongrass, pepper, and more. A guided spice escursione à arranged from Stone Town and typically half a day à is a sensory journey through the island's most fragrant heritage. Marine Life & Nature

Zanzibar's Natural Wonders

Beneath Zanzibar's surface à both on land and under the sea à lies an extraordinary concentration of natural life. The island's marine environment encompasses a vast system of fringing coral reefs, seagrass beds, mangrove forests, and deep Indian Ocean channels, supporting a marine biodiversity that rivals the best reef systems in Africa orientale.

The Mnemba Island Marine Conservation Area, 3 km off the northeast coast, is the jewel of Zanzibar's underwater world à protecting over 600 species of coral reef fish, five species of sea turtle (including the endangered hawksbill and green turtle, which nest on Mnemba's beaches), three species of dolphins, whale sharks, and seasonal humpback whales. On land, La foresta di Jozani ospita il colobo rosso di Zanzibar à a species found nowhere else on Earth, with a wild population of only around 3,000 individuals. The forest's combination of mahogany, coral rag forest, and mangroves also supports bush babies, mongoose, Sykes' monkeys, and over 40 bird species.

Zanzibar's marine ecosystem is under significant conservation pressure from overfishing, coral bleaching events, and coastal development à but marine protected areas, community-based conservation, and sustainable tourism certification programmes are stabilising key reef systems. Conservation

Protecting Zanzibar's Natural Heritage

??
Zanzibar Red Colobus Conservation
The Zanzibar red colobus monkey (Piliocolobus kirkii) is one of Africa's most endangered primates à found only on Unguja island with a wild population of approximately 3,000 individuals. Jozani Chwaka Bay Parco Nazionale was established specifically to protect this species. La Lista Rossa IUCN la classifica come in pericolo di estinzione. The park's management programme tracks individual troops, monitors habitat health, and works with surrounding communities to manage the boundaries between farmland and forest à the primary source of human-colobus conflict.

Sea Turtle Protection à Nungwi & Mnemba
Le tartarughe marine verdi ed embricate nidificano sulle spiagge di Zanzibar, in particolare sull'isola di Mnemba e lungo la costa settentrionale vicino a Nungwi. The Nungwi Marine Turtle Conservation Lagoon à a community-managed tidal pool that rehabilitates injured turtles before release à has been operating for over two decades and represents one of Africa orientale's most successful community-based marine conservation projects. Il programma di monitoraggio delle tartarughe dell'isola andBeyond Mnemba monitora la nidificazione delle tartarughe verdi dal 1996.

Coral Reef Restoration
Zanzibar's coral reefs have been significantly affected by the mass bleaching events of 1998, 2016, and 2019, driven by rising Indian Ocean temperatures. The Chumbe Island Coral Park à established in 1994 as Africa orientale's first privately managed marine protected area à has served as a model for community-led reef conservation, with coral monitoring, no-take zones, and sustainable tourism financing proving highly effective. Nelle acque di Zanzibar sono attivi, sotto il coordinamento della IUCN e del WWF, diversi progetti di ripristino della barriera corallina che utilizzano la coltivazione dei coralli e strutture artificiali della barriera corallina.
